    Abstract: A stent removal device for removing or repositioning a stent from within a lumen is provided. The stent typically comprises at least one element arranged circumferentially about the stent. The stent removal device includes a tube positioned within the lumen proximate to the stent, wherein the tube is capable of receiving at least a portion of the stent. The stent removal device also includes a pusher positioned within the tube capable of engaging the stent and/or the element. The stent removal device further includes a hook positioned within the tube and including a hook member capable of engaging the element such that force applied to the hook causes the stent to purse string.

    Abstract: Systems and methods for processing glycerol into one or more products and uses thereof are provided. In one or more embodiments, a method for treating soil can include applying a partially oxidized reaction product to a soil. The partially oxidized reaction product can be prepared by decreasing a pH of a mixture that includes glycerol and fatty acids to produce a mixture that includes a glycerol-rich portion and a fatty acids-rich portion. The glycerol-rich portion can be reacted with at least one of an oxidant and a catalyst at conditions sufficient to produce the partially oxidized reaction product.

    Abstract: Systems and methods for processing glycerol into one or more products are provided. In at least one specific embodiment, the method can include decreasing a pH of a mixture comprising glycerol and fatty acids to produce an emulsion comprising a glycerol-rich portion and a fatty acids-rich portion. At least a portion of the glycerol-rich portion can be reacted with an acid comprising phosphorus at conditions sufficient to produce a reacted product comprising glycerophosphoric acid, glycerol, and a portion of the acid.

    Abstract: A lumen measuring device generally includes a central member dimensioned to extend into a lumen and an elongate outer member having a flexible region configured to flex outward from the central member in response to retraction of the central member. In measuring a lumen, the flexible region is caused to contact the lumen. The lumen may be contacted by linear segments that hinge or by members that bow arcuately. A polygon, such as a triangle, may be defined by portions of the outer member and the central member. A handle assembly may be provided by which the disposition of the central member relative to the outer member may be adjusted. Indicators may be defined by the central member and outer member by which the disposition of the central member and by which the diameter of a lumen may be determined.

    Abstract: The present invention, in an exemplary embodiment, provides a therapeutic medical appliance, delivery device and method of use. In particular, plug therapeutic medical appliances are provided that allow for the intervenfional treatment of pulmonary disorders such as defects characterized by pulmonary blebs and/or diffused destructive parenchymal disease. The plug therapeutic medical appliances themselves combine many of the excellent characteristics of both silicone and metal therapeutic medical appliances while eliminating the undesirable ones. In particular, these therapeutic medical appliances are preferably self-expanding in nature and allow the predetermined differential selection of relative hardness/softness of regions of the therapeutic medical appliance to provide additional patient comfort. An exemplary embodiment also provides a family of delivery devices that facilitate flexibility, durability and/or proper installation of one or more medical appliances in a single procedure.
